CSV parsing with univocity library in java


I am using univocity to parse an large (6 GB) CSV in java. The CSV enrty is as below and can parse CSV. Any idea how to generate the output as below:

CsvParserSettings settings = new CsvParserSettings();   
settings.getFormat().setLineSeparator("\n");

CsvParser parser = new CsvParser(settings);

File f = new File("test.csv");
parser.beginParsing(f, "UTF-8");


String[] row;

while ((row = parser.parseNext()) != null) {

       String val = Arrays.toString(row);

       val = val.replaceAll("\\[", "");
       val = val.replaceAll("\\]", "");
       val = val.replaceAll("\\s", "");


       System.out.println(val);


} // end while

test.csv content:

A,10,2,3

null,11,A1,null

null,30,A23,null

null,44,A34,null

null,16,A67,null

A,20,5,6

null,41,A100,null

null,60,A56,null

null,74,A34,null

null,86,A56,null

Trying to get output like below:

A,[10;11;30;44;16],[2,A1,A23,A34,A67],3

A,[20;41;60;74;86],[5,A100,A56,A34,A56],6

Solution

  • Each line of expected output depends on multiple rows. Each cell value should be stored in an intermediate variable. Accordingly code can be written as follows:

        BufferedReader csv = new BufferedReader(new FileReader("test.csv"));
    
        String line;
    
        ArrayList<String> ar1 = new ArrayList<String>();
        ArrayList<String> ar2 = new ArrayList<String>();
    
        String s1=null,s2=null;
    
        String[] lineSplit;
    
        while ((line = csv.readLine()) != null){
    
            lineSplit = line.split(",");
            if(lineSplit.length>1){ 
                if(!lineSplit[0].equals("null")){
    
                    if(!ar1.isEmpty()){
    
                        System.out.println(s1+","+ar1.toString().replaceAll(", ", ";")
                                           +","+ar2.toString().replaceAll(", ", ",")+","+s2);
                    }
    
                    s1 = lineSplit[0] ;
                    s2 = lineSplit[3];
                    ar1 = new ArrayList<String>();
                    ar1.add(lineSplit[1]);
                    ar2 = new ArrayList<String>();
                    ar2.add(lineSplit[2]);
                }
                else{
                    ar1.add(lineSplit[1]);
                    ar2.add(lineSplit[2]);
                }
            }
        }
    
        System.out.println(s1+","+ar1.toString().replaceAll(", ", ";")
                   +","+ar2.toString().replaceAll(", ", ",")+","+s2);
    
        csv.close();
